My first car was ruined because I neglected the oil. This is something to schedule and stay on top of. You can probably do this yourself, but if you take it to be professionally done be advised that there are big price differences between services, so shop around. 

Did you know that you can have small  dents repaired without affecting the paint? It is called paintless dent repair or PDR for short. 

You probably have car insurance, at least I hope so, but have you considered roadside assistance. Our car got stuck once in an unusual way and I was surprised that our heavily loaded insurance did not cover any type of pulling or tow without an extra $200. Did you know that there are services for around $20 a month that will come and get you and two your car or bring you some gas in the case of a problem or an issue on a trip? Some of these services even will get you a motel and a car rental if there is an accident! Look online and compare the services. I would go with a company that is national and has been around more than a decade.
